Description
Shut-off gate valves serve as devices for hermetic shut-off of water and steam pipelines of the main technological systems of stations and enterprises. They are used only for switching on or switching off the pipeline. Use of gate valves as regulating devices is not allowed.
Connection to the pipeline: under welding. Installation position on the pipeline: any. Direction of medium supply: any.
Gate tightness: according to class A of GOST 9544-2015. Placement category: 1, 2, 3 according to GOST 15150-69. Climatic execution: ?, ??, ???,?
according to GOST 15150-69.
